Hi, I would also think in case someone creates a QEP, that an announcement of the QEP in the dev mailinglist would help, because not everyone checks all the repositories every day ...
Anyway - it would be great if devs and customers could inform each other better about their plans - which wasn't always the case in the past. Suddenly, a cool new feature appeared in master - but maybe someone else had a similar idea at the very same time and it would be a waste of time if people don't know from each others plans.
